LUMBERTON — Southeastern Hospice will hold a training course for new volunteers interested in assisting hospice patients and their families in homes or at Southeastern Hospice House.

Prospective volunteers are required to attend all sessions, which will be held Tuesday and Thursday mornings, Sept. 8 through Sept. 27, from 9:30 a.m. until noon at Southeastern Hospice House, located at 1100 Pine Run Drive in Lumberton. Volunteers must consent to a background check as well as a TB skin test and flu vaccination. The background check, test and vaccination will all be paid for.

Each volunteer session is designed to increase awareness of issues important to the care of dying patients and their families, including hospice philosophy; grief; concepts of dying; family dynamics; communication skills; and aging.
